Understanding Cannabidiol’s Role

Recent research suggests that cannabidiol (CBD), a non-psychoactive compound found in cannabis, may offer potential benefits in treating attention deficit hyperactivity disorder (ADHD). This exploration centers around CBD’s interaction with the body’s endocannabinoid system, which plays a crucial role in regulating various physiological processes. However, the complexities surrounding both ADHD and the effects of cannabis present significant challenges for researchers in this field.

The Cannabis Conversation: A Growing Interest

Cannabis is often touted as a remedy for a multitude of conditions, ranging from anxiety and sleep disorders to epilepsy and chronic pain. As interest in cannabis for medicinal purposes grows, Dr. Jennie Ryan, a nursing researcher at Thomas Jefferson University, is investigating how cannabis specifically impacts ADHD symptoms. Traditional ADHD treatments, such as Adderall and cognitive behavioral therapy, can be effective but often come with side effects. Dr. Ryan notes that many parents are curious about CBD, especially since it does not contain THC, the compound responsible for the psychoactive effects of marijuana. However, she cautions that the scientific backing for such treatments is still lacking.

Reviewing the Scientific Evidence

In a recent review, Dr. Ryan and her team examined existing scientific literature to assess the relationship between cannabis use and ADHD symptoms. They found that while there is some evidence suggesting that cannabis may influence ADHD, the findings are not definitive. The researchers focused on the endocannabinoid system, which is naturally produced by the body and may play a role in managing symptoms of ADHD. Their analysis of clinical and preclinical studies indicates that cannabis interacts with this system in various ways that could impact attention, hyperactivity, and anxiety levels.

Despite these findings, Dr. Ryan emphasizes the complexity of the relationship. The wide range of cannabis products, the different types of endocannabinoids, and the variability in how ADHD presents in individuals all contribute to the challenges researchers face. “Teasing all these factors apart is super complicated,” she explains.

Legal Hurdles in Cannabis Research

Adding to the complexity is the legal landscape surrounding cannabis research. Many researchers encounter obstacles due to restrictions on studying marijuana, which can hinder progress in understanding its potential benefits and risks for conditions like ADHD. Dr. Brooke Worster, a co-author of the study and a specialist in pain management, noted the surprising gaps in published evidence regarding cannabis and ADHD. “We have a lot of work ahead,” she stated, acknowledging the need for further research to fill these voids.

What’s Next for Cannabis and ADHD Research?

Looking ahead, Drs. Ryan and Worster are planning to publish results from a second survey examining cannabis use among adults with ADHD. This ongoing research aims to provide a clearer picture of how cannabis may influence ADHD symptoms and treatment options.
